Overview of Christian Fellowship House

Thrive in a home-like environment supported with personalized care at Christian Fellowship House, a novel senior living community in Nassau County, Syosset, NY, offering assisted living. Residents are welcomed into individually decorated accommodations surrounded by 10 acres of rolling hills and scenic views of grazing horses. With only 45 residents, the community team members can focus on providing attentive and compassionate care with thorough understanding of each individual’s needs and abilities.

Residents dealing with Alzheimer’s and Dementia or other conditions are provided the care and support they need to continue living a thriving lifestyle. A 24/7 aides and live-in management team members ensure residents’ concerns and emergencies are addressed urgently. Comprehensive services, including home cooked meals, personal care, housekeeping services, and special personal services, ensure residents live comfortably and conveniently. With most of their chores and needs handled, residents can focus on living their lives to the fullest and participate in vibrant activities.

Managed by Pamela Horvath

Administrator

Pamela Horvath was appointed as the administrator of Christian Fellowship House in April 2009. She worked closely with her father, Rev. Paul Steffens, until his passing in 2012, continuing the family’s long-standing tradition of compassionate care and spiritual encouragement for seniors at this family-operated, non-denominational facility.

Care Types in This Table AL (Assisted Living): Housing with help for daily activities like bathing, dressing, and medication, without 24-hour skilled nursing. MC (Memory Care): Secured, specialized care for people living with Alzheimer's or dementia. RESC (Residential Care): Personal care and daily-living support in a smaller, more intimate residential setting. IL (Independent Living): Community living with dining, activities, and transportation for active seniors who need little personal care. HC (Home Care): Professional care delivered in the person's own home, from companionship to skilled nursing.

Community First Choice Option

NY Medicaid CFCO

Age 65+ or disabled
General New York resident, Medicaid- eligible, care need (not necessarily nursing home level).
Income Limits (2025) ~$2,829/month 300% FBR, individual
Asset Limits $30,182 individual, higher due to NY Medicaid expansion
NY

Higher asset limit; urban density increases demand.

Benefits
Personal care (5-7 hours/day) Respite care (240 hours/year) Home modifications ($1,500 avg.) Assistive technology ($500 avg.)

Expanded In-Home Services for the Elderly Program (EISEP)

NY EISEP

Age 60+
General New York resident, at risk of decline but not nursing home level.
Income Limits ~$2,500/month individual, varies
Asset Limits $15,000 individual
NY

Cost-sharing required above certain income; urban/rural balance.

Benefits
In-home care (3-5 hours/week) Respite (up to 10 days/year) Case management Transportation (~5 trips/month)
